1.下载源码
2.解压和编译
3.拷贝 redis-2.8.3/src 目录下可执行文件到指定目录
4.设置 redis 后台启动、缓存数据:修改 redis.conf 文件
5.启动服务
6.测试服务
7.注意:make 和 make install 区别
- 下载源码:地址
解压和编译
wget http://download.redis.io/releases/redis-2.8.3.tar.gz tar xzf redis-2.8.3.tar.gz cd redis-2.8.3 make
拷贝 redis-2.8.3/src 目录下可执行文件到指定目录
mkdir /usr/redis cp redis-server /usr/redis cp redis-benchmark /usr/redis cp redis-cli /usr/redis cp redis.conf /usr/redis cd /usr/redis
设置 redis 后台启动、缓存数据:修改 redis.conf 文件
daemonize yes appendonly yes
启动服务
redis-server redis.conf
测试服务
redis-cli redis> set foo bar OK redis> get foo "bar"
注意:make 和 make install 区别
- make 编译的意思
- make install 会把编译好的可执行文件拷贝到当前用户的可执行目录下
/usr/local/bin
- 如果不想把可执行文件放到 /usr/local/bin 下面就不要执行 make install 命令,而是手动的把可执行文件拷贝到自己想要安装的目录下面。
- 如果出现了编译错误:说明缺少编译的环境,安装一下:yum -y install gcc gcc-c++ libstdc++-devel